I don't know what's specifically at LAX, but V8 SUVs in Hertz's fleet include the Chevy/GMC Tahoe/Yukon/Suburban, Nissan Armada, and Toyota Sequoia. The turbocharged-V6 Ford Expedition is also in that class, though TBH I'm not a big fan of that engine in the F-150. As for the luxury brands, they should have the Cadillac Escalade and Infiniti QX80, but be prepared to pay a considerable premium for those.

Originally Posted by stimpy
I got an upgrade to a Lincoln Navigator at IAD earlier this year and that is definitely a V8.
Only until MY 2014 though - the 2015+ Expedition and Navigator have the V6 "Ecoboost".
